ICE skaters from the Isle of Wight will show their support for young Eli Wells, who plans to climb Mount Snowdon for charity.
The skaters have organised a 5k fun run on February 17 to raise funds for Eli’s trip.
The six year old, who has autism, hopes to raise £1,000 from the challenge.
The fun run, which is open to all, will take place at Goddards Brewery, Ryde, at 1pm.

Meanwhile, the Wight Jewels synchronised skating team recently took on top international skaters in a competition in Austria.
They performed two clean routines, to the delight of their coach, Terri Smith.
She said: “I could not be prouder of them.”
